Replacement of ground services vehicles with customized and more realistic for the region at ALL airports in North America (Continental US and Canada).The addon is available to be purchased through the LatinVFR website for a decent price of $9.99 which is equal to about €8.30. Of course, not to forget, the developers from LatinVFR have included custom sounds for the vehicles as well as custom logos for the companies placed on the vehicles. Users can select from nine airline companies and the most important catering companies from the area. Coverage in Mexico is not included.Īll vehicles have specific liveries for the area relatable to the real companies. The addon makes an effect on all airports in the United States and Canada. The addon replaces the default ground service vehicles in the North American region of the simulator, and so enhances the environment with vehicles common in the area.

It is also a stop for Caribbean cruises by cruise lines Carnival, Celebrity, Crystal, Disney, Royal Caribbean, and others.” This remarkable island has many interesting aspects including: Maya culture history, stunning coral reefs, incredible marine life and many appealing resorts to have wonderful and perfect vacations. The island is about 48 km (30 mi) long and 16 km (9.9 mi) wide, and is Mexico’s largest Caribbean island. It is located at the Caribbean Sea off the eastern coast of Mexico’s Yucatan Peninsula, very near to Cancun. “ Cozumel International Airport is situated in the island of Cozumel, Quintana Roo.
